Razor Clam (Pinna bicolor), also called razor fish, has a long narrow shell, roughly the shape of an old-fashioned cutthroat razor, and is harvested in sand or mud near the low water mark on very sheltered bays in SA. Cooking Pippies, Clams, Vongole & Cockles: Buying Clams, Cockles...
